Starz Entertainment (STRZ) Q2 2026 earnings summary
Event summary combining transcript, slides, and related documents.
Q2 2026 earnings summary
12 Aug, 2026Executive summary
Delivered strong Q2 2026 results in OTT with high-performing original content and increased engagement, highlighted by the 'Fightland' premiere.
Revenue for Q2 2026 was $307.9 million, down 3.7% year-over-year, with OTT revenue returning to growth and linear revenue declining due to industry trends.
Net loss from continuing operations for Q2 2026 was $189.4 million, driven by significant restructuring and contract termination costs.
Expanded distribution through new partnerships (Peacock, Crunchyroll), increasing reach and marketing opportunities.
Strategic focus remains on organic growth, disciplined capital allocation, and selective M&A.
Financial highlights
Adjusted OIBDA for Q2 2026 was $59.9 million, up from $33.4 million in Q2 2025, reflecting lower programming amortization.
Operating loss for Q2 2026 was $175.5 million, primarily due to non-recurring restructuring charges.
Unlevered free cash flow was negative $14.7 million for Q2 but positive $66 million year to date.
Cash and cash equivalents increased to $59.6 million as of June 30, 2026.
Cash content spend for the quarter was $182 million, with full-year spend expected below $600 million.
Outlook and guidance
Raised 2026 adjusted OIBDA growth guidance from low to mid-single digits.
Unlevered free cash flow outlook increased to the mid to upper end of $80 million-$120 million.
Confident in achieving 20% adjusted OIBDA margin target in the back half of 2027.
Management expects continued pressure on linear revenue and is focused on cost containment and content portfolio optimization.
Cash flow from operations, cash on hand, and undrawn credit facilities are expected to be sufficient for operational and debt service needs for the next twelve months and beyond.
